On June 25 a SUMMER TANAGER and a WHITE-WINGED CROSSSBILL were at Meadows
Campground near Camp Sherman. A female ROSE-BREASTED GROSBEAK was seen June
22 at the Tualatin NWR. The Malheur NWR Headquarters BROWN THRASHER was seen
again June 25.

Up to 10 WESTERN SANDPIPERS and a SEMIPALMATED PLOVER were seen during the
week at Dunes Overlook south of Florence. A MOCKINGBIRD was seen June 24 at
nearby Tahkenitch Creek. A group of five WESTERN SCRUB-JAYS was at South
Beach June 24. On June 26 northbound migrant BROWN PELICANS and HEERMANN?S
GULLS were passing Yaquina Head. Up to 373 RAVENS gathered during the week
on a field near Astoria.

Up to 17 GREAT EGRETS have been reported during the week near Scappoose. On
June 27 a LARK SPARROW was at the Sandy River Delta. Two EASTERN KINGBIRDS
are being seen there again this summer. A flock of 30 WHITE PELICANS was
over mid-town Eugene June 24. Another GRASSHOPPER SPARROW colony was found
during the week along North Bank Road near Glide.

On June 26 a VEERY was seen along Lake Creek near Camp Sherman.
